A critical investigation has been launched following the fatal shooting of a man in Young on Friday night.
Police from Cootamundra Local Area Command spoke with a man on Cloete Street at 11.45pm on Friday after he was seen with a firearm.
A short time later, the man sustained a gunshot wound and died at the scene.
No police firearms were discharged and no officers were injured.
A critical incident team from The Hume Local Area Command will investigate the circumstances and all information will be provided to the Coroner, who will determine the cause of death.
